#1846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1846ad is composed of 9.4% red, 27.5%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.1%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 221.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 38.6%. #1846ad color hex could be obtained by blending #308cff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#1846ad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1846ad has RGB values of R:24, G:70,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 1590957.

Shades and Tints of #1846ad
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eff3fd is the lightest one.
